PITTSBURGH, Dec. 11, 2024 ~ Bakersfield inventor creates a versatile solution for fishermen with the FISHING ROD HOLDER. The innovative design, created by an inventor from Bakersfield, Calif., provides a secure and convenient way to store fishing rods and other necessary items while fishing.

The idea for the FISHING ROD HOLDER came to the inventor while he was out fishing and realized there was a need for a better way to secure his rods and keep other tools easily accessible. "I needed a better way to secure fishing rods and other items at a fishing spot," said the inventor.

The FISHING ROD HOLDER is not only designed to prevent rods from being pulled in or damaged, but it also allows fishermen to multitask without worrying about their equipment. The holder can also be used to store other tools such as hammers, pliers, scissors, and spools, increasing convenience and visibility for fishermen.

The portable design of the FISHING ROD HOLDER makes it easy to use and ideal for fishing enthusiasts. The original design was submitted to the Fresno sales office of InventHelp and is currently available for licensing or sale to manufacturers or marketers.
